The hidden cost most lines miss
In many SMT environments today, operators still spend 30–45 seconds locating and picking a single reel. Hours every week disappear into searching, walking, and second-guessing — material that should already be structured.
Because it happens a few seconds at a time, nobody really notices the true cost.
The math on a typical line
Based on a setup handling 500 reels per day (picking + storing):
- ▸Traditional shelves + manual handling: ~1940 working hours/year
- ▸Nordec Smart Racks with pick-to-light: ~247 working hours/year
That's almost a full working year reclaimed — and importantly, this example is based on only 30 seconds per manual pick. In many real production environments, the actual time can be significantly higher depending on layout, structure, and operator experience.
